Kabul: At least two people, including the deputy governor of Kabul, Mahbubullah Muhibbi, were killed in a blast in the national capital on Tuesday morning.
The other deceased was identified as his secretary.
Two of Mahbubullah Muhibbi's bodyguards were also wounded.

The blast took place around 9:40 am in Kabul's Macroryan 4 area in the city's PD9 when an IED that was placed on the vehicle exploded, a police statement said.
No group, including the Taliban, has claimed responsibility for the blast so far.
